Question

If 18, a, (b - 3) are in AP, then find the value of (2a – b)

Advertisements

Solution

It is given that 18, a,(b-3) are in AP.

∴ a-18 = (b-3) -a

⇒ a+a-b = 18-3

⇒ 2a -b = 15

Hence, the required value is 15.
